Ok, currently typing from a USB keyboard on my laptop.

Basically when it boots up, all fine, i can click to logon as a user, but as soon as i touch the keyboard on the laptop, it stops the laptop keyboard and the touchpad for mouse working.

If I logon using the USB keyboard, the touchpad works until I press a button on the laptop.

Any ideas? Nothing at fault in Device Manager, but am gonna try and update the driver. Other than that, all i can think is that the keyboard connection is loose or something, but just weird that it stops the touchpad working as well

Had this before on a few laptops. Main culprit is the keyboard itself or the controller.

As you say, check the keyboard connection (most modern laptops are fairly easy to get the keyboard out), if nothing, then look online for a replacement unit.
